That tradition continues in the 41st year. Discontinued several years— ago due to safety concerns with horses around the large, noisy steam engines, the equine are back ploughing, discing and cultivating during demonstrations Friday and Saturday at 10:30 a.m. and 2:30 p. m., as well as Sunday at 12:30 p.m. Since the expansion of the campgrounds has provided a barrier between the demonstrations, which are located west of the general event, and the activity involving steams engines and tractors, the concerns regarding safety have been lessened considerably.
